What Makes Charcoal the Best Choice for Grilling Ribeye?

Charcoal is considered the best choice for grilling ribeye due to its unique properties that enhance flavor and cooking performance.

  • High Heat Generation: Charcoal burns at a higher temperature compared to other grilling fuels, which is essential for achieving the perfect sear on ribeye steaks.
  • Flavor Enhancement: The smoke produced by burning charcoal infuses a rich, smoky flavor into the meat, elevating the taste of the ribeye.
  • Control Over Cooking Temperature: With charcoal, grillers can easily adjust airflow and the arrangement of coals, allowing for precise temperature control during cooking.
  • Longer Cooking Time: Charcoal burns longer than propane or electric grills, providing more time to cook thick cuts of ribeye evenly without frequent refueling.
  • Versatility in Cooking Techniques: Charcoal allows for various cooking methods, such as direct and indirect grilling, making it easier to achieve desired doneness for ribeye steaks.

High Heat Generation: Charcoal burns at a higher temperature compared to other grilling fuels, which is essential for achieving the perfect sear on ribeye steaks. This intense heat caramelizes the meat’s exterior, creating a delicious crust while keeping the inside juicy and tender.

Flavor Enhancement: The smoke produced by burning charcoal infuses a rich, smoky flavor into the meat, elevating the taste of the ribeye. The natural wood flavors from certain types of charcoal can also complement the beef’s richness, making each bite more flavorful.

Control Over Cooking Temperature: With charcoal, grillers can easily adjust airflow and the arrangement of coals, allowing for precise temperature control during cooking. This flexibility helps prevent overcooking and enables the grillers to achieve a perfect medium-rare ribeye.

Longer Cooking Time: Charcoal burns longer than propane or electric grills, providing more time to cook thick cuts of ribeye evenly without frequent refueling. This is particularly advantageous for those who prefer to cook larger steaks or multiple pieces at once.

Versatility in Cooking Techniques: Charcoal allows for various cooking methods, such as direct and indirect grilling, making it easier to achieve desired doneness for ribeye steaks. Grillers can start with high heat for searing and then move the steak to a cooler part of the grill to finish cooking gently.

How Do Different Types of Charcoal Affect Ribeye Flavor?

Different types of charcoal can significantly influence the flavor profile of grilled ribeye steak.

  • Wood Charcoal: Wood charcoal is made from burning wood in a low-oxygen environment, which retains the natural flavors of the wood. This type of charcoal can impart unique flavors based on the type of wood used, such as hickory, mesquite, or cherry, enhancing the ribeye’s rich taste with complex smoky notes.
  • Charcoal Briquettes: Charcoal briquettes are manufactured from compressed sawdust and other materials, which can include binders and accelerants. While they provide a consistent heat source, they may produce a milder flavor compared to natural wood charcoal and can sometimes impart a chemical taste if not well-made or if they burn too hot.
  • Natural Lump Charcoal: Natural lump charcoal is made from whole pieces of hardwood and is often favored for its clean-burning properties and rich flavor. It lights quickly and burns hotter than briquettes, allowing for a more authentic smoky flavor to develop on the ribeye without the additives found in some briquettes.
  • Fruitwood Charcoal: Fruitwood charcoal, such as apple or peach, is derived from fruit trees and delivers a sweeter, milder smoke flavor. This type of charcoal can beautifully complement the ribeye’s natural richness, offering a subtle fruity undertone that enhances the overall taste experience.
  • Mesquite Charcoal: Mesquite charcoal is known for its intense flavor and high heat, often associated with traditional Texas barbecue. While it can add a robust smoky flavor to the ribeye, it should be used sparingly as its strong taste can overshadow the meat’s natural flavors if overused.

What are the Advantages of Using Lump Charcoal for Grilling Ribeye?

The advantages of using lump charcoal for grilling ribeye include enhanced flavor, higher cooking temperatures, and ease of use.

  • Enhanced Flavor: Lump charcoal is made from natural hardwood, which imparts a rich, smoky flavor to the ribeye as it cooks. This process elevates the overall taste experience, making your steak more delicious compared to using briquettes or gas.
  • Higher Cooking Temperatures: Lump charcoal burns hotter than traditional briquettes, allowing for better searing of the ribeye. This high heat helps to develop a perfect crust on the steak while keeping the inside juicy and tender.
  • Faster Lighting: Lump charcoal ignites quickly and requires less time to reach cooking temperature, making it a convenient choice for spontaneous grilling. This efficiency is ideal for those who want to enjoy a delicious ribeye without long wait times.
  • Less Ash Production: Compared to briquettes, lump charcoal produces significantly less ash, which means less cleanup after grilling. This characteristic allows you to focus more on cooking and enjoying your meal rather than dealing with remnants of burnt material.
  • Natural Ingredients: Since lump charcoal is made from pure wood without additives or chemicals, it is a healthier option for grilling. This purity ensures that no unwanted flavors or toxins are introduced to your ribeye, allowing the natural flavors of the meat to shine through.

In What Ways Do Briquettes Enhance the Grilling of Ribeye?

Briquettes enhance the grilling of ribeye in several key ways:

  • Consistent Heat: Briquettes provide a steady and prolonged heat source, which is essential for cooking ribeye evenly. This consistency allows the steak to achieve a perfect sear on the outside while maintaining the desired level of doneness inside.
  • Flavor Enhancement: The slow-burning nature of briquettes contributes to a rich, smoky flavor that complements the natural taste of ribeye. As they burn, they release aromatic compounds that infuse the meat, adding depth to the overall flavor profile.
  • Temperature Control: Briquettes allow for better temperature management on the grill, making it easier to create zones for direct and indirect cooking. This is particularly useful for ribeye, as it can be seared over high heat and then moved to a cooler area to finish cooking without overcooking.
  • Convenience and Ease of Use: Briquettes are typically easy to light and maintain, making the grilling process more user-friendly. Their uniform shape and size contribute to a predictable burning time, allowing grillers to plan their cooking more effectively.
  • Cost-Effective: Compared to lump charcoal, briquettes are generally more affordable and widely available, making them a practical choice for grilling ribeye. This cost-effectiveness allows for more frequent grilling sessions without significant expense.

Which Charcoal Brands Are Considered the Best for Ribeye?

The best charcoal brands for grilling ribeye steak are known for their ability to produce high heat and impart great flavor.

  • Royal Oak Charcoal: This brand is recognized for its high-quality lump charcoal, which lights quickly and burns hot. Its natural wood flavor enhances the taste of the ribeye, making it a favorite among grill enthusiasts.
  • Kingsford is a popular choice due to its consistent burn and easy-to-use briquettes. The added ingredients help maintain a steady temperature, which is crucial for achieving the perfect sear on ribeye steaks.
  • Fogo Super Premium Charcoal: This lump charcoal is made from 100% natural hardwood, providing an excellent flavor profile. Its large chunks burn for a long time and reach high temperatures, ideal for grilling ribeye to perfection.
  • Jealous Devil Charcoal: Known for its ultra-premium hardwood lump, Jealous Devil offers a clean burn with minimal ash production. This results in a pure flavor experience, allowing the rich taste of the ribeye to shine through.
  • Big Green Egg Natural Lump Charcoal: Specifically designed for use in Kamado-style grills, this charcoal lights easily and burns hotter than many other options. Its unique blend of woods provides a distinctive flavor, enhancing the overall grilling experience of ribeye steaks.

How Can You Maximize Flavor When Grilling Ribeye with Charcoal?

To maximize flavor when grilling ribeye with charcoal, consider the following techniques:

  • Use High-Quality Charcoal: Starting with premium charcoal can greatly enhance the flavor of your grilled ribeye. Lump charcoal burns hotter and cleaner than briquettes, providing a better sear and imparting a subtle smoky flavor that complements the rich taste of the ribeye.
  • Season Generously: Proper seasoning is crucial for enhancing the natural flavor of the ribeye. A simple mix of coarse salt and freshly cracked black pepper can create a delicious crust, while marinating with herbs, garlic, and oil can add depth and complexity to the meat before grilling.
  • Achieve the Right Temperature: Preheating the grill ensures that the ribeye cooks evenly and gets those desirable grill marks. Aim for a high heat (around 450°F to 500°F), which allows for a good sear on the outside while keeping the inside juicy and tender.
  • Use the Reverse Sear Method: For thicker cuts, consider using the reverse sear technique, where you cook the ribeye indirectly at a lower temperature before searing it over direct heat. This method helps to evenly cook the meat and maximizes tenderness and flavor.
  • Let it Rest: Allowing the ribeye to rest for at least 5-10 minutes after grilling is essential for flavor retention. This resting period all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, resulting in a more succulent and flavorful bite.
  • Add Wood Chips for Extra Smoke: Incorporating wood chips, such as hickory or mesquite, into your charcoal can infuse the ribeye with additional smoky flavor. Soak the chips in water for about 30 minutes and place them directly on the hot coals for the best effect.
  • Experiment with Finishing Sauces: A finishing sauce, such as a chimichurri or compound butter, can elevate the flavor profile of your grilled ribeye. These sauces add freshness and richness that can enhance the overall dining experience.

What Common Mistakes Should You Avoid When Grilling Ribeye on Charcoal?

When grilling ribeye on charcoal, there are several common mistakes to avoid for the best results.

  • Insufficient Preheating: Failing to preheat your charcoal grill can lead to uneven cooking and a lack of sear on the meat. Preheating allows the grill grates to reach the optimal temperature, ensuring a nice crust forms on the ribeye while keeping the inside juicy and tender.
  • Not Using Enough Charcoal: Using too little charcoal can result in inconsistent heat and longer cooking times. It’s essential to use a sufficient amount of charcoal to maintain high temperatures, which are crucial for searing the ribeye properly.
  • Skipping the Seasoning: Some people neglect to season their ribeye adequately before grilling. A good seasoning mix, such as salt and pepper, enhances the natural flavors of the beef and helps create a delicious crust when grilled.
  • Flipping Too Frequently: Constantly flipping the ribeye can prevent it from developing a proper sear and can lead to uneven cooking. It’s best to let the steak cook on one side until it naturally releases from the grill before flipping it only once.
  • Not Letting It Rest: Cutting into the ribeye immediately after grilling can result in lost juices, making the steak dry. Allowing the meat to rest for a few minutes post-grilling redistributes the juices throughout the steak, resulting in a more flavorful and moist experience.
  • Ignoring Carryover Cooking: Many grillers forget that ribeye will continue to cook after being removed from the grill due to residual heat. It’s important to account for this carryover cooking and take the steak off the grill a few degrees below your desired doneness.
